A Grade II listed monument, this war memorial is a tall, imposing stone cross with a pedestal base, adorned with carved inscriptions and wreaths, standing proudly in a small park area surrounded by mature trees and a tranquil atmosphere, serving as a poignant tribute to the local men who lost their lives during World War I.
